10 / 16 page ![]() EP5358LUI/EP5358HUI Excess bulk capacitance on the output of the device can cause an over-current condition at startup. The maximum total capacitance on the output, including the output filter capacitor and bulk and decoupling capacitance, at the load, is given as: EP5358LUI: COUT_TOTAL_MAX = COUT_Filter + COUT_BULK = 230uF EP5358HUI: COUT_TOTAL_MAX = COUT_Filter + COUT_BULK = 115uF EP5358LUI in external divider mode: COUT_TOTAL_MAX = 2.086x10 -4/V OUT Farads The above numbers and formula assume a no load condition. Over Current/Short Circuit Protection The current limit function is achieved by sensing the current flowing through a sense P- MOSFET which is compared to a reference current. When this level is exceeded the P- FET is turned off and the N-FET is turned on, pulling VOUT low. This condition is maintained for approximately 0.5mS and then a normal soft start is initiated. If the over current condition still persists, this cycle will repeat. Under Voltage Lockout During initial power up an under voltage lockout circuit will hold-off the switching circuitry until the input voltage reaches a sufficient level to insure proper operation. If the voltage drops below the UVLO threshold the lockout circuitry will again disable the switching. Hysteresis is included to prevent chattering between states. Enable The ENABLE pin provides a means to shut down the converter or enable normal operation. A logic low will disable the converter and cause it to shut down. A logic high will enable the converter into normal operation. NOTE: The ENABLE pin must not be left floating. Thermal Shutdown When excessive power is dissipated in the chip, the junction temperature rises. Once the junction temperature exceeds the thermal shutdown temperature the thermal shutdown circuit turns off the converter output voltage thus allowing the device to cool. When the junction temperature decreases by 15C°, the device will go through the normal startup process. www.altera.com/enpirion Page 10 03541 October 11, 2013 Rev F |
